▎ 摘  要

NOVELTY - A lithium-ion battery graphene nano sheet-cobaltous oxide composite cathode material comprises graphene nano sheet and cobaltous oxide, where the graphene nano sheet is distributed on cobaltous oxide grain in staggering way. The thickness of graphene nano sheet is 1-50 nm, with mass fraction of 5-90%; and the residue is cobaltous oxide and the particle size of cobaltous oxide is 10-500 nm. USE - Lithium-ion battery graphene nano sheet-cobaltous oxide composite cathode material. ADVANTAGE - The reverse capacity of the material can be stabilized more than 900 mAh/g.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is included for a preparation of lithium-ion battery graphene nano sheet-cobaltous oxide composite cathode material, comprising dispersing graphite oxide in alcohol-water solution or aqueous solution (10-2000 pts.wt.), performing ultrasonic treatment at room temperature for 0.5-12 hours or stirring for 0.5-12 hours, adding (pts.wt.) cobalt salts (0.1-9), alkali (0.1-2) and reducing agent (0.1-1), and adjusting pH of 8-15, stirring and pouring into water hydrothermal kettle; and sealing and reacting for 1-72 hours at 60-300 degrees C, washing and filtering, drying in vacuum at 50-100 degrees C, processing under protection atmosphere at 200-800 degrees C for 0.5-10 hours, and obtaining lithium-ion battery graphene nano sheet-cobaltous oxide composite cathode material.
